Is one cup of coffee a day healthy or unhealthy?
Individuals who reported drinking at least one cup of caffeinated coffee each day had an associated decreased long-term heart failure across all three major studies. More specifically, in two of the studies (Framingham Heart Study and Cardiovascular Health Study), over the course of decades, heart failure risk decreased by 5-12% per cup of coffee per day in comparison to those who didn’t drink coffee.

Why you should not drink coffee?
Studies have shown that drinking a moderate amount of coffee is associated with many health benefits, including a lower risk of developing type 2 diabetes and cardiovascular disease. But while these associations have been demonstrated many times, they don’t actually prove that coffee reduces disease risk.

Which coffee is healthiest?
Yet, not all coffee products are the same and some are much healthier than others. So, which type of coffee is the healthiest? Regular black coffee is undoubtedly the healthiest choice. It has about 5 calories per cup, meaning you can drink even more without gaining weight.

· An average cup of coffee contains approximately 18g of green coffee so each kg of green coffee makes approximately 56 espresso beverages. The carbon footprint of your espresso beverage is 0.28 and 0.06 kg CO 2e for conventional and sustainable coffee respectively (9.2 and 2.1 g CO 2e mL -1 ).
